Transaction 6f733d262055ca438ccea809a933f93bf80c4c19adbd25cfe21fadad627f7117

3 Input
1 Outputs
  • 6f733d262055ca438ccea809a933f93bf80c4c19adbd25cfe21fadad627f7117:0
  • value  3387191
    address  37ViCwGVs8Tt7gAtbrqWm9D3iRb3PWi3tf